The Manu Amazon tour starts with a hotel pickup in Cusco early in the morning, between 5:30 a.m. and 6:00 a.m., in a comfortable private bus. Along the way, we will stop to admire the Funerary Towers or Chullpas of Ninamarca, located at 3,750 meters above sea level, and learn a bit about their history.
Next, we will make a short stop in Paucartambo, a charming town with a colonial bridge and a rich local tradition. Then we continue to the high area of the town, in the Acjanaco sector, at 4,000 meters above sea level, which marks the official entrance to Manu National Park.
From here, we will descend into the cloud forest, a mysterious and vibrant ecosystem where you can see orchids, heliconias, and ancient ferns. During a short walk, you may witness the amazing mating ritual of the Cock-of-the-Rock (Rupicola peruvianus), Peru’s national bird, and possibly see other birds like Trogons (Trogon sp.), Quetzals (Pharomachrus sp.), and if you are lucky, the elusive Spectacled Bear (Tremarctos ornatus).
At the end of the day, we reach the picturesque town of Pilcopata, at 550 meters above sea level, where our cozy traditional lodge awaits. The lodge is away from the town and offers comfortable rooms with private bathrooms, perfect for resting and enjoying the jungle surroundings.

After enjoying a delicious breakfast, we continue our journey by bus to Atalaya, a 45-minute ride reaching 490 meters above sea level. Upon arrival in Atalaya, we will board a boat for about 30 minutes to reach Rainforest Lodge, our overnight accommodation set in a typical jungle environment with private bathrooms and showers for your comfort.
During the boat ride, you will have the chance to see wildlife in their natural habitat, enjoying the peace and beauty of the Amazon rainforest. After a tasty lunch, in the afternoon we will head to Cocha Machuwasi, where we will take a ride on a local catamaran to observe a wide variety of birds, including the Hoatzin (Ophisthocomus hoazin), as well as monkeys, reptiles, small caimans, and insects. With some luck, we may also spot capybaras (Hydrochaerus hydrochaeris).
Later in the evening, those interested can join an optional Night Trek, an exciting experience to explore the jungle after dark and discover its hidden wildlife. Afterward, we return to Rainforest Lodge, where you can relax and enjoy private bathrooms and showers in a cozy and comfortable setting.


On the final day of our 3-day Manu tour, we will start early in the morning with a 45-minute boat ride to the parrot clay lick, a wall of mineral-rich clay. Here, we can witness the amazing gathering of 3 to 4 species of green parrots, arriving in large numbers to feed on the natural salts and minerals in the clay.
After this unique experience, we will enjoy a delicious breakfast before continuing our journey. We return by boat to Atalaya and then continue by bus, passing through Pilcopata (550 meters above sea level), Patria, and Chontachaca, once again crossing the beautiful and mysterious cloud forest on our way back to the city of Cusco.
Along the route, we will have the chance to admire the cloud forest and its rich jungle scenery one last time. We expect to arrive in Cusco between 6:30 p.m. and 7:00 p.m., concluding this unforgettable Manu adventure.

Manu National Park is in southeastern Peru, covering parts of Cusco and Madre de Dios. With over 1.5 million hectares, it is one of the most biodiverse protected areas in the world.
